如何快速让PS3手柄在Windows重获新生:3步终极指南
2025/12/17 13:04:05
在脚本编程中,浮点运算和数字进制转换是常见的需求。下面将详细介绍如何创建计算浮点数平均值的脚本,以及如何进行不同数字进制之间的转换。
我们可以对加法脚本进行一些小的修改,从而计算一系列数字的平均值。以下是具体的修改步骤:
为了计算数字列表的平均值,我们需要知道列表中数字的总数,以便将总和除以这个总数。在对$NUM_LIST中的数字进行有效性检查时添加计数器,确保这些数字是整数或浮点数。
TOTAL_NUMBERS=0 for NUM in $NUM_LIST do ((TOTAL_NUMBERS = TOTAL_NUMBERS + 1)) case $NUM in +([0-9])) # Check for an integer : # No-op, do nothing. ;; +([-0-9])) # Check for a negative whole number : # No-op, do nothing ;; +([0-9]|[.][0-9])) # Check for a positive floating point number : # No-op, do nothing